  • The main objective of this work is to propose a reliable routine standard operation procedures (SOP) for structural health monitoring and diagnosis of nuclear power plants (NPPs). At present, NPPs have monitoring systems that can be used to obtain the quantitative health record of containment (CTMT) buildings through system identification technology. However, because the measurement signals are often interfered with by noise, the identification results may introduce erroneous conclusions if the measured data is directly adopted. Therefore, this paper recommends the SOP for signal screening and the required identification procedures to identify the dynamic characteristics of the CTMT of NPPs. In the SOP, three recommend methods are proposed including the Recursive Least Squares (RLS), the Observer Kalman Filter Identification/Eigensystem Realization Algorithm (OKID/ERA), and the Frequency Response Function (FRF). The identification results can be verified by comparing the results of different methods. Finally, a preliminary CTMT healthy record can be established based on the limited number of earthquake records. It can be served as the quantitative reference to expedite the restart procedure. If the fundamental frequency of the CTMT drops significantly after the Operating Basis Earthquake and Safe Shutdown Earthquake (OBE/SSE), it means that the restart actions suggested by the regulatory guide should be taken in place immediately.

  • Standard Operating procedures (SOPs) provide a degree of assurance that an operation will be performed consistently by different people and also consistently by the same person at different times. An SOP is a written set of instructions that someone should follow to complete a job safely, with no adverse effect on personal health or the environment, and in a way that maximizes operational and production requirements. Basic categories of SOPs include purpose, scope, reference document, definition, responsibility, procedure, and so on. In this work, we introduce SOPs for bioprocess.

  • Disasters in South Korea are taking on more diverse and intricate aspects than before, while being affected by the industrial development and deterioration of the cities. Therefore, it is urgently needed for success in disaster countermeasures to secure emergency communications operating system which would make it possible to share various information between the control tower and field personnel quickly and accurately. This study proposes a method of improving the national emergency communications operating system based on the Federal disaster management system, emergency communications system, and Standard Operating Procedures (SOPs) employed in the US, which is the leading country in the field of disaster management. First, the organization of the emergency communications needs to be more systematized than in the past. The organization of the emergency communications of the central and local governments have to be administered according to their different roles and objectives. Furthermore, they must cooperate with each other based on interoperability. Second, emergency communications councils need to be established, composed of representatives related to disasters, and national and regional units need to be formed and operated separately. Third, the SOPs should not only cover both the operational and technical elements, but also assign the roles and responsibilities to the members of the disaster communications system. These improvements will assure the correct functioning of the disaster communications system in the field, which is expected to increase the probability of success in disaster countermeasures.

  • This study examines the development of content scenarios to facilitate the training of on-site commanders in firefighting activities. To establish the training content scenario system, the three core competencies of the on-site commanders were set as situation judgment, communication, and decision-making. A system of scenarios was established to actively reflect these three core competencies when designing the scenarios. All the contents of these scenarios are based on Standard Operating Procedures (SOP). The scenarios comprise 14 stages that are divided into four steps with the exception of stages 1 and 14, which mark the beginning and end of the training. It consists of the situation setting stage and the first, second, and third decision-making stages. Specifically, situation judgment and communication are important factors in each stage.

  • Backgrounds : Taiwan has similar national health insurance (NHI) system for traditional medicine with South Korea. Recently, new quality improvement policies for traditional medicine is being attempted in Taiwan. Objectives : This study aimed to review the Taiwanese NHI system for Chinese Medicine (CM) and introduce quality improvement policies. Methods : Research articles, reports, government publications and year books which handled traditional medicine system and NHI system in Taiwan were searched and collected. The authors analyzed and summarized the contents in a qualitative manner. Results : In Taiwanese NHI system, CM procedures and medication for outpatients are reimbursed through a mix of fee-for-service and global budget payment system. CM shares 4% of total expenditure of NHI in Taiwan. Mostly, the expenses for procedures are reimbursed regardless of disease type, however, in the specialized program for quality improvement, CM doctors have to comply with standard operating procedures (SOPs). Conclusions : Taiwanese NHI system implemented SOP-based new reimbursement system for CM. Yet, the scientific evidences for SOPs are not sufficient, it can be useful references when we develope disease related reimbursement system for Korean Medicine in South Korea.

  • Objectives: Rapid Intervention Crews (RIC) are indispensable for rescuing firefighters who are lost or trapped. They are included in Disaster Scene Standard Operating Procedures. This study was conducted to examine the use of RIC at emergency scenes in South Korea. Methods: We conducted a nationwide survey of 4,913 firefighters in South Korea. The firefighters' experiences of use of RICs were assessed by asking, "How often are RICs available at fires?" Results: A full 40.8% of firefighters answered that they 'never' have RICs available at fires. Another 8.4% responded that they 'always' have RICs available, which is much lower than the rate among US firefighters (19.9%). RICs are available more often for firefighters in the capital area than for firefighters outside the capital area (13.4% vs. 5.1%, p<0.001). The larger the jurisdiction served, the more likely the firefighters were to have RICs available (p<0.001). Conclusions: These results imply that firefighters in South Korea are at risk. It is necessary to recruit personnel to improve the use of RICs and to explicitly include RICs in SOPs, training, and business plans.
